What is JAKAPA?

JAKAPA measures, trains, and tracks soft skills. Bad soft skills are the #1 reason someone will be fired, and bad manager soft skills are a top reason why great employees quit. JAKAPA helps businesses improve their productivity and decrease turnover by providing data-driven answers to 3 of our client’s critical questions about training and engagement:
1. Are my company’s employee development initiatives actually working?
2. How can I help my employees improve their soft skills outside of training and feedback sessions?
3. How do I catch employee development disengagement early so I can intervene before it becomes permanent?
We achieve this using reliable and validated assessment technology, daily soft skill challenges, and an actionable dashboard. JAKAPA gives management and individual employees data clarity around their real-time strengths, weaknesses, and engagement metrics.

What is Total Orbit?

Total Orbit offers turn-key proprietary software WITH services from engagement experts to create personalized digital learning and engagement environments. Each custom-created “orbit” leverages an organization’s existing information and educational tools to create personalized journeys and tracks that engagement down to the individual user level, with system triggers in support of desired outcomes. While the platform and process is widely applicable to various industries and use cases, the core product – CareOrbit – focuses on healthcare in support of patient engagement and education. Orbits are tailored to each patient’s diagnosis, prognosis, and treatment plan and are delivered via a responsive, device agnostic web app. It’s like a virtual mentor in the palm of their hand for the 99% of the time patients are not directly in front of their care team.

What is V15ABLE?

V15Able is an online career development platform for people with disabilities and for any employer looking to hire talented, capable candidates. Disabled candidates will finally be empowered to prove their potential to employers through our specialized portfolios designed with cutting edge user experience techniques. Employers will finally have access to the presently untapped potential of the disabled workforce. By simply making disabled candidates “v15able” to employers, In addition to all the support and educational materials V15Able provides for people with disabilities, they will have each other in creating a community. Together their connections, endorsements and recommendations can build confidence and provide much needed support. Additionally, we will be providing employers with curated resources to encourage hiring PWDs, such as tax incentives for hiring disabled workers or educational resources on how to create inclusive workspaces, how to explore alternative work models, and more.

What is Generation Mindful?

Generation Mindful (GEN:M) creates tools, toys, and programs that nurture emotional intelligence through play and positive discipline. A direct to consumer e-commerce company, GEN:M enjoys a passionate community of parents, educators, and therapists in more than 45 countries who share in its mission to raise emotionally healthy children. Children aren’t born knowing how to regulate their emotions anymore than they are born knowing how to tie their shoes. GEN:M teaches families and classrooms vital social and emotional skills with products that take the latest findings in brain research and child development practically and playfully into everyday life.
